Italian
Etymology
From pilastro + -ino (diminutive suffix).
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/pi.laˈstri.no/
- Rhymes: -ino
- Hyphenation: pi‧la‧strì‧no
Noun
pilastrino m (plural pilastrini)
- a small column or pillar (especially one of a series)
